Output 528c9670a71343dc2873bf892a2f976e46050251570bb76cbb22a0b2d3491801:30

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4786368cfe8134fbdf9903b53c0b1fba5c07d10f OP_EQUAL
address
38DCgTCr219nVbMLzf2tBriaRTuteApcY5
transaction
528c9670a71343dc2873bf892a2f976e46050251570bb76cbb22a0b2d3491801
confirmations
275029
spent
true